Tuition, Attendance & Policies
Important studio rules and payment information.
Tuition is due on the 1st of each month. LRJ Dance operates on a monthly billing cycle.
A $25 late fee will automatically be applied to accounts not paid by the 1st of the month.
If an account is more than 30 days past due, the student may be asked to sit out of class until the balance is cleared or may be dropped from class.
No. Tuition is non-refundable.
We do not offer credits for missed classes due to illness, vacations, or personal scheduling conflicts.
To discontinue classes, a 30-day written notice via email is required.
Please arrive 5–10 minutes before class so dancers can stretch, prepare, and be ready to start on time.
Students arriving more than 15 minutes late may be asked to observe rather than participate to help prevent injury, since they missed the warm-up.
Students must be fever-free for at least 24 hours before returning to class.
Water only is allowed in the dance studio.
Food, gum, and sugary drinks are not permitted.
Phones must be silenced and kept in bags. They are not permitted on the dance floor unless the instructor specifically requests them for filming choreography.
